The influence of aluminium on the ferrite formation and microstructural development in hot rolled dual-phase steel
This research paper explores the fundamental effect of intentional aluminium additions within a low carbon dual phase steel for automotive applications. This novel alloy development work, has led to the introduction of novel UK produced (Tatasteel UK) DP grades based on aluminium additions, It is proven unambiguously the dramatic effect on the range of production gap temperatures employed in Industrial practices (low cost implications), thus enabling consistent mechanical properties and easier hot mill processing (increased revenue) for these novel strip steel grades.
